Q1: What are the key elements influencing the spread of consumer innovations according to the diffusion of innovations theory?

A1: The diffusion of innovations theory, popularized by Everett Rogers, identifies five main elements influencing the spread of a new idea: the innovation itself, adopters, communication channels, time, and a social system. These elements are crucial in determining how and at what rate new ideas and technology are adopted in a social system.

Q2: How is generative AI impacting firm productivity in online retail, as per recent studies?

A2: Recent studies have shown that the adoption of generative AI in online retail significantly enhances firm productivity. Through experimental data, it's found that AI integration in consumer-facing workflows increases sales by up to 16.3%, with improvements in total factor productivity. This technology reduces marketplace friction and improves consumer experience, leading to higher conversion rates.

Q4: What are the safety concerns associated with chemical ingredients in commercial sunscreens, and what solutions have been proposed?

A4: There are significant safety concerns regarding the systemic absorption of active ingredients in commercial sunscreens. To address these, researchers have proposed encapsulating chemical UV filters like octyl methoxycinnamate in biodegradable microcapsules. This method enhances UV absorption while minimizing skin penetration, offering a safer sunscreen application.

Q5: How do disruptive innovations differ from other types of innovations in the market?

A5: Disruptive innovations create new markets or value networks or enter at the bottom of existing markets, eventually displacing established market leaders. Unlike sustaining innovations, which improve existing products, disruptive innovations tend to come from outsiders or startups and involve higher risks but can achieve faster market penetration once implemented.

Q7: How does the concept of 'the marketing chasm' relate to the adoption of new innovations?

A7: The 'marketing chasm' refers to the gap between early adopters and the early majority in the adoption curve of new innovations. This chasm represents the challenge of transitioning a product from niche appeal to mass adoption, often requiring strategic marketing efforts to bridge the gap and achieve widespread acceptance.
